Output 242896204ef7d3d33c8796662b3a0b581176f4224831d08379cfb34631a930c2:0

value
26704356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688c84cc86cee207c3abe9286d9fd6ef9d2d7aec OP_EQUAL
address
3BDpXubtxku5NYPxdiD3g7yh6NEQtmt6Ln
transaction
242896204ef7d3d33c8796662b3a0b581176f4224831d08379cfb34631a930c2
spent
true